如何在python123上运行numpy
时间: 2024-05-09 21:20:24 浏览: 5
要在Python123上运行NumPy,需要先安装NumPy模块。您可以使用以下命令在命令提示符或终端中安装NumPy:
```
pip install numpy
```
安装完成后,您可以在Python代码中导入NumPy模块并使用它的功能。例如:
```python
import numpy as np
a = np.array([1,2,3])
b = np.array([4,5,6])
c = a + b
print(c)
```
这个代码块将创建两个NumPy数组,将它们相加并将结果打印到控制台。
相关问题
python 将numpy.array序列化
你可以使用pickle模块将numpy数组序列化。pickle模块是Python标准库中用于对象序列化和反序列化的工具。
下面是一个示例代码,演示如何使用pickle将numpy数组序列化和反序列化:
```python
import numpy as np
import pickle
# 创建一个numpy数组
arr = np.array([1, 2, 3, 4, 5])
# 序列化数组
serialized_arr = pickle.dumps(arr)
# 反序列化数组
deserialized_arr = pickle.loads(serialized_arr)
print(deserialized_arr)
```
运行以上代码,你将得到输出结果为 `[1 2 3 4 5]`。
注意,pickle模块可以处理任何可序列化的Python对象,包括numpy数组。使用pickle进行序列化和反序列化时,需要注意安全性和版本兼容性。
Traceback (most recent call last): File "C:\Users\George\PycharmProjects\pythonProject9\venv\123.py", line 4, in <module> import numpy as np ModuleNotFoundError: No module named 'numpy'
这个错误提示表明您的 Python 环境中缺少 NumPy 模块。NumPy 是一个 Python 库,用于支持大量的数值计算和数组操作。在运行您的代码之前,请确保您已经成功安装了 NumPy。您可以在终端或命令行中使用以下命令安装 NumPy:
```
pip install numpy
```
如果您使用的是 Anaconda,也可以使用以下命令:
```
conda install numpy
```
安装完成后,您可以尝试重新运行代码,看看问题是否已经解决了。